Bursaries to Support the Professional Development of Hospice Staff (England, Wales, the Channel Islands & the Isle of Man)

Bursaries are available to help hospice staff in England, Wales, the Channel Islands and the Isle of Man improve the quality of care given to patients in need of hospice and palliative care, and to their families and carers.

The Masonic Charitable Foundation Bursaries for Hospice Staff will support the professional development of individual staff, significantly increasing their expertise in the work they do, rather than training or updating them in the basic skills needed for their role.

All applicants must be working in an eligible organisation as either a:

  • Nurse
  • Healthcare Assistant
  • Doctor
  • Allied Health Professional
  • Social Worker
  • Bereavement Counsellor
  • Administration Staff (HR, Finance, Fundraising)
  • Spiritual Care Worker
  • Pharmacist
  • Complementary Therapists.

Bursaries can be used to cover a maximum of 80% of university accredited course or module fees, up to £1,500 in any one year. Match funding is encouraged.

Applications can be made at any time until all funding is exhausted.
